Filming Dates Set for ‘Armor Wars’ and ‘Spider-Man 4’ in 2025 According to Reports

Share:

The MCU currently has numerous projects in development, both movies and shows, despite Iger’s announcement that their creative output will significantly decrease to 2-3 movies and 2 live-action shows per year.

Many projects were greenlit before the SAG-AFTRA strike and the subsequent failure of several ventures, and now they need to be completed.

One such project is ‘Armor Wars.’ Initially conceived as a movie, it was redeveloped into a show, and now it’s back to being a movie again. According to the production schedule, ‘Armor Wars’ is set to begin filming on January 6, 2025, in Atlanta, USA. Although details about the movie are scarce, the production listing has provided a brief synopsis:

Cheadle returns as James Rhodes aka War Machine in Armor Wars, about Tony Stark’s worst fear coming true: what happens when his tech falls into the wrong hands. Stark discovers that someone has been stealing his Iron Man tech and selling it to supervillains. He decides he must do whatever it takes to reacquire — or destroy — the stolen tech.

Lois D’Esposito is listed as a producer alongside Kevin Feige, with Sarah Finn credited as the casting director and Yassir Lester as the writer. Currently, the only confirmed cast member for the project is Don Cheadle. Additionally, Sam Rockwell has reportedly been in talks with executives to reprise his role as Justin Hammer.

‘Spider-Man 4’ is also scheduled to begin production on the same day, January 6, in Los Angeles. The synopsis for the movie states the following:

Rumored plot points for Spider-Man 4 include the introduction of Venom and Miles Morales to the MCU. Additionally, Spider-Man may team up with Daredevil to confront Kingpin. Production to start in the begining of 2025.

Here’s where we encounter a significant issue: the accompanying data are quite outdated. While this is common for production listings, it does reduce their credibility somewhat.

According to the listing, Jon Watts is still set to direct the movie, with Jonathan Bell, Lois D’Esposito, and Kevin Feige as producers. Erik Sommers and Chris McKenna are listed as writers, with Sarah Finn as the casting director. The listing mentions Tom Holland as the only confirmed cast member, despite recent confirmations that Zendaya will reprise her role.

Holland also recently mentioned that the script is not yet finished and that they are exploring several different sources. So, take this ‘Spider-Man’ listing with a grain of salt.
